In miscue analysis, the reader describes what happened in the story after reading aloud.

Explanation:
Retelling is the act of recounting the story after reading aloud to show comprehension. In miscue analysis, you look at how a reader decodes the text during reading, and you also check understanding by asking them to retell what happened, which reveals their grasp of the plot, characters, and sequence. The other terms refer to different concepts: VAKT relates to learning styles; a running record notes reading behaviors and errors as they occur; a rubric is a scoring guide used to judge performance.
